Queen Spa’s bamboo massage, and why it feels different

In Da Nang, you can find lots of massage options. What makes this one stand out is the tool. The therapy uses bamboo stems that, on average, need to be about three years old. That detail matters because bamboo changes as it matures, and the spa’s method leans on the way hot bamboo interacts with muscle, circulation, and comfort.
The massage itself is described as a mix of traditional Vietnamese techniques and natural herbal ingredients. You’re also not just getting bamboo, you’re getting bamboo plus natural oils and essential oils. In plain terms, the spa is trying to hit two goals at once: loosen tight areas and leave you feeling more comfortable in your skin and body afterward.
Queen Spa also puts effort into atmosphere. The spa rooms are designed in different styles and are scented with herbal smells, so you’re not walking into a generic treatment room. Even if you arrive tired, that kind of setting helps you switch from street mode to recovery mode.
One more important point: this is positioned for people who like medium to strong massage. If you prefer light touch, this may feel too intense. If you like to leave with your shoulders feeling worked, it is exactly the category it targets.

Hot bamboo plus natural oils: the practical benefits to look for

The spa’s promise is specific. Hot bamboo massage is meant to help with:
- back and shoulder pain relief
- skin health support
- stimulation of blood circulation
- deep relaxation
You should treat these as the spa’s stated benefits, not medical guarantees. But you can still decide if it fits your needs.
If your main goal is shoulder tension, this is a logical pick. Hot tools tend to feel effective for tight muscles because they add warmth to the work. The oils and essential oils are there to support glide and comfort, so the session is less about scraping the skin and more about a smoother, warmer touch.
If your skin is sensitive right now, read the eligibility details carefully. The experience is not suitable for anyone with skin diseases, or for anyone whose skin is peeling from strong sunburn. If you are coming straight from the beach, this matters.
If you are choosing this as a recovery day after sightseeing, it can be a smart move. Bamboo and oil bodywork can feel like a reset button for the kind of stiffness people get from scooters, car rides, and long walks.
